摘要:
内存管理机制 python中垃圾回收机制主要有三方面:引用记数主,标记清除,分代回收为辅 引用计数(没有人记得你时,才是真正的死亡) 在python中一切皆为对象,每个对象都维护一个引用次数,如果次数为零,即没有任何引用,它将被回收机制无情的收割(没有人赢得你时,才是真正的死亡.鲁迅也曾说:有的人死 阅读全文
摘要:
内存管理机制 python中垃圾回收机制主要有三方面:引用记数主,标记清除,分代回收为辅 引用计数(没有人记得你时,才是真正的死亡) 在python中一切皆为对象,每个对象都维护一个引用次数,如果次数为零,即没有任何引用,它将被回收机制无情的收割(没有人赢得你时,才是真正的死亡.鲁迅也曾说:有的人死 阅读全文
摘要:
DRF serializer serializer中的类并不多,主要有BaseSerializer, serializer, ListSerializer, ModelSerializer, HyperlinkedModelSerializer,它们之间的继承关系如下:没错,它们的父类是Field. 阅读全文
摘要:
DRF view View DRF中的view分成三个等级,最基本的APIView, 到GenericAPIView,再到GenericViewSet. Django用“视图”这个概念封装处理用户请求并返回响应的逻辑。视图是一个可调用对象,它不仅可以是基于函数,也可以是基于类的。函数是通过判断req 阅读全文
摘要:
win10 pycharm virtualenv python3.5 google 能查到的方法基本都试了,but no use. 最后安装的twisted 17.9.0 如果要下载独立的twisted 17.9.0 whl 包,可以云这里: https://github.com/zerodhate 阅读全文
摘要:
1.在app (这里以user为例)下面的__init__.py文件中 添加: 2.在apps.py中 阅读全文
摘要:
如图: 但我在后端打印出来的html 标签都是正常的,如下: 那这到底是什么原因导致的呢, 显然是在传递给前端时出错了,经过排查, 可以看到这里了少了一单引号,导致后面内容未正常结束.修改后即可正常显示. 阅读全文
摘要:
在写博客的例子时,遇到的问题: 有两个涉及到choice field: 最后 的结果是: 我知道在模板中是可以通过下面的方式来实现 由于这用的是xadmin的后台,所以用这种方式是不现实的 那么有没有在python代码中实现的方法呢, 方法如下: 同时这里注意到,第二个choice field中的s 阅读全文
摘要:
项目中使用了xadmin, 并且我的UserProfiles 继承了django 自带的User,并重写了一些字段 最后 在xadmin中注册时,我按照下面这样的方式注册: 出现了上面的错误: 最后解决办法是: 先注销UserProfiels, 再重新注册. 然后运行命令: 阅读全文
摘要:
在写django ModelForm时遇到这了该错误: 经查找后发现: 上面的LoginForm在定义时,error_messages 字段对应的错误提示应该是字典,但第一个username的字典中间误写成了逗号,导致了该错误 将其修改后为冒号后,一切正常. 阅读全文
摘要:
布尔值。指示用户的账号是否激活。我们建议把这个标记设置为False 来代替删除账号;这样的话,如果你的应用和User 之间有外键关联,外键就不会失效。 它不是用来控制用户是否能够登录。认证的后端没有要求检查is_active 标记,而且默认的后端不会检查。如果你想在is_active 为False 阅读全文
|